Grace Ji-Sun Kim (an haife ta a watan Mayu 4, 1969) masanin tauhidin Ba'amurke ne kuma Farfesa na Tiyoloji a Makarantar Addini ta Earlham, Richmond, Indiana. An fi saninta da litattafai da labarai kan abubuwan zamantakewa da na addini na matan Koriya da suka ƙaura zuwa Arewacin Amirka .

Rayuwar farko

[gyara sashe | gyara masomin]

An haifi Kim a ranar 4 ga Mayu, 1969, a Seoul, Koriya ta Kudu . Ta yi ƙaura tare da danginta zuwa London, Ontario a cikin 1975.

Rayuwar ilimi

[gyara sashe | gyara masomin]

Kim ya sami B.Sc. a Psychology daga Jami'ar Victoria a Jami'ar Toronto, Jagoran Divinity Divinity daga Knox College, Jami'ar Toronto a 1995, da Ph.D. a cikin Tiyolojin Tsari daga St. Michael's College, Jami'ar Toronto a 2001.

Kim ya yi aiki a sashin Moravian Theological Seminary a Bethlehem, PA daga faɗuwar 2004 zuwa Yuli 2013. A lokacin da take a Moravian, an kara mata girma zuwa Mataimakin Farfesa a 2010 kuma ta yi aiki sau biyu a matsayin Darakta na shirin MATS. An nada Kim a Cocin Presbyterian (Amurka) a ranar 13 ga Nuwamba, 2011. A halin yanzu ita ce Farfesa na Tiyoloji a Makarantar Addini ta Earlham a Richmond, Indiana. [1]

Kim ya sami kyautar sabbatical ga masu bincike daga Cibiyar Louisville a cikin 2020. [1]

A halin yanzu, Kim Farfesa ne na Tiyoloji a Makarantar Addini ta Earlham. Ita ce marubuciya ko editan litattafai sama da 20, kwanan nan, Hope in Disarray; Tsayar da Fata Rayayye; Reimagining Ruhu da Intersectional Tiyoloji tare da Susan Shaw. Ita ce babbar editan littafin 'Kiristancin Asiya a cikin Diaspora', wanda Palgrave Macmillan ya buga. [2]
